Bumbu Kacang Wings

Ingredients
- Peanut Butter Sauce:
- 2 ounces Jif® Natural Peanut Butter Sauce
- 2 ounces hoisin sauce
- 3 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1 teaspoon sesame oil
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 2 ounces water
- Wings:
- 24 chicken wings, drumettes and flats, raw
- Chopped cilantro
- Chopped dry roasted peanuts
Directions
Preheat deep fryer to 350°F.
Combine peanut butter sauce with the remaining sauce ingredients in a large bowl, set aside for later use.
Deep fry wings for 10–12 minutes or until chicken wings reach a minimum internal temperature of 165°F.
Drain excess oil from chicken wings and then pour into reserved sauce bowl. Toss wings in sauce until thoroughly coated.
Divide wings onto two serving plates. Garnish plates with chopped cilantro and peanuts.
